## Reviewing GridForge Changes

GridForge is our crossword generator; most pull requests touch either the fill engine or the clue bank. Watch for changes to the backtracking heuristics — they can silently degrade fill quality, so require benchmark output in the PR description. Clue-bank edits need a second reviewer from the Puzzles guild. Style conventions and the benchmark harness instructions are documented on the internal page below.

runbook for badug-kadup: https://confluence.zemvarlabs.internal/projects/browse/display/projects/bd1b

MEMO TO THE BOARD

Varnell Systems disputes our license scope on the Quillbrook toolkit, claiming our Ostermark deployment exceeds seat limits. Counsel disagrees but flags ambiguity in clause 7. Settlement talks begin Thursday; exposure estimated at mid six figures. No public comment until resolved. Recommend authorizing counsel to settle below threshold. The confidential note below outlines our fallback position.

board note of kageg-bahof: The renewal with Holwynax Holdings closes at $2 million a year, 5 percent below the last contract. Project Ulaath slips by two quarters because of the supplier delay.

Changelog — Quillbase 4.2. Default SQL lint rules changed. Trailing commas now flagged as errors, not warnings. Keyword casing enforcement switched from lower to upper. Implicit cross joins are blocked outright. Max line length dropped from 140 to 100. If your files passed under 4.1, re-run the linter before pushing; most fixes are auto-applied with the --fix flag. Legacy profiles are removed, no opt-out. The new default configuration shipped with this release is as follows.

deployment values, hahip-kajep:
HOLAX_PIN=4003
HOLAX_METRICS_HOST=metrics.holax.zemvarworks.internal
HOLAX_LOG_LEVEL=warn
HOLAX_TENANT=fraael

**Weekly cash-box run.** Every Friday the petty-cash box goes from reception to the Dunmere counting office via Larkspool Couriers. Box stays locked, key stays with us — never send both together. Office manager signs the out-log and notes the seal tag. Hand the box over only once the rider gives this phrase:

courier memo of yawep-yafog: the pramir ulaix courier leaves the ulavan aldix frair zorok oliiel joreth rusdor fenvan ledger at gate 1305 under passcode 514738